Today, Benzinga's options scanner spotted 12 uncommon options trades for CVS Health.

This isn't normal.

The overall sentiment of these big-money traders is split between 50% bullish and 50%, bearish.

Out of all of the special options we uncovered, 3 are puts, for a total amount of $308,910, and 9 are calls, for a total amount of $390,045.

What's The Price Target?

Taking into account the Volume and Open Interest on these contracts, it appears that whales have been targeting a price range from $37.5 to $75.0 for CVS Health over the last 3 months.

Where Is CVS Health Standing Right Now?

  • With a volume of 6,618,202, the price of CVS is down -0.53% at $69.17.
  • RSI indicators hint that the underlying stock is currently neutral between overbought and oversold.
  • Next earnings are expected to be released in 26 days.

What The Experts Say On CVS Health:

  • JP Morgan has decided to maintain their Overweight rating on CVS Health, which currently sits at a price target of $106.
  • Truist Securities has decided to maintain their Buy rating on CVS Health, which currently sits at a price target of $103.
